ATSAM3S4CA-AU - Mikrocontroller, Cortex M3, 64MHz, 256KB Flash,48KB RAM,QFP-100
9,50 €
Variante
Der SAM3S4C ist ein Mitglied der SAM3S-Serie von Microchip, die auf dem leistungsstarken 32-Bit ARM® Cortex®-M3 RISC-Prozessor basiert. Er arbeitet mit einer maximalen Geschwindigkeit von 64MHz und verfügt über 256KB Flash-Speicher und 48KB SRAM. Die umfangreiche Peripherie umfasst einen Full-Speed-USB-Geräteanschluss mit integriertem Transceiver, eine Hochgeschwindigkeits-Multimedia-Kartenschnittstelle für SDIO/SD/MMC, eine externe Busschnittstelle mit einem Controller für statischen Speicher, der mit SRAM, PSRAM, NOR-Flash, LCD-Modul und NAND-Flash verbunden ist, zwei USARTs, zwei UARTs, zwei TWIs (I2C), drei SPIs, I2S, PWM-Timer, sechs 16-Bit-Timer, RTC, 15-Kanal-12-Bit-ADC, 2-Kanal-12-Bit-DAC und einen Analogkomparator.Die QTouch-Bibliothek bietet eine einfache Möglichkeit zur Implementierung von Tasten, Rädern und Schiebereglern. Der parallele Datenerfassungsmodus auf den PIOs ergänzt die externe Busschnittstelle für die Datenerfassung von externen Geräten, die nicht mit Standard-Speicherleseprotokollen konform sind, wie z.B. preiswerte Bildsensoren. DMA überträgt die Daten in den Speicher und entlastet die CPU.Der Baustein arbeitet mit Spannungen von 1,62V bis 3,6V und ist in 100-Pin-QFP- und QFN-Gehäusen erhältlich und Pin-zu-Pin-kompatibel mit dem SAM3N4C. ARM® Cortex®-M3 Revision 2.0 läuft mit bis zu 64 MHzSpeicherschutzeinheit (MPU)DSP-Befehle, Thumb®-2-Befehlssatz256 KByte eingebetteter Single Plane Flash, 128-Bit breiter Zugriff, Speicherbeschleuniger48 KByte eingebetteter SRAM16 KByte ROM mit integrierten Bootloader-Routinen (UART, USB) und IAP-Routinen8-Bit Static Memory Controller (SMC): Unterstützung von SRAM, PSRAM, NOR und NAND FlashExterne Busschnittstelle - 8-Bit-Daten, 4 Chip Selects, 24-Bit-AdresseEingebauter Spannungsregler für Single-Supply-BetriebPower-on-Reset (POR), Brown-out Detector (BOD) und Watchdog für sicheren BetriebQuarz- oder Keramikresonator-Oszillatoren: 0,6 bis 30 MHz Hauptleistung mit Ausfallerkennung und 32,768 kHz mit geringer Leistung für RTC oder GerätetaktHochpräziser 8/12 MHz werkseitig getrimmter interner RC-Oszillator mit 4 MHz Standardfrequenz für den Gerätestart. Trimmzugriff in der Anwendung zur FrequenzanpassungLangsam taktender interner RC-Oszillator als permanenter Gerätetakt im EnergiesparmodusZwei PLLs mit bis zu 130 MHz für den Gerätetakt und für USBTemperatursensorBis zu 22 periphere DMA-Kanäle (PDC)Sleep- und Backup-Modus, bis zu < 2 µA im Backup-ModusRTC mit extrem niedrigem Stromverbrauch100-poliges LQFP, 14 x 14 mm, Abstand 0,5 mm100-Ball TFBGA, 9 x 9 mm, Abstand 0,8 mmIndustriell (-40° C bis +85° C)USB 2.0-Gerät und Embedded Host: 12 Mbps, bis zu 8 bidirektionale Endpunkte und Multi-Packet-Ping-Pong-Modus. On-Chip-TransceiverUSB 2.0-Gerät: 12 Mbit/s, 2668 Byte FIFO, bis zu 8 bidirektionale Endpunkte. On-Chip-Transceiver2 USARTs mit ISO7816, IrDA®, RS-485, SPI, Manchester und Modem-ModusZwei 2-Draht UARTs2 Zweidrahtschnittstellen (I2C-kompatibel), 1 SPI, 1 serieller Synchroncontroller (I2S), 1 Hochgeschwindigkeits-Multimedia-Kartenschnittstelle (SDIO/SD Card/MMC)zwei 3-Kanal-16-Bit-Timerzähler mit Erfassungs-, Wellenform-, Vergleichs- und PWM-Modus. Quadratur-Decoder-Logik und 2-Bit-Gray-Vor-/Rückwärtszähler für Schrittmotor4-Kanal-16-Bit-PWM mit komplementärem Ausgang, Fehlereingang, 12-Bit-Totzeitgenerator-Zähler für Motorsteuerung32-Bit-Echtzeit-Timer und RTC mit Kalender- und Alarmfunktionen32-Bit-Berechnungseinheit für zyklische Redundanzprüfung (CRCCU)79 E/A-Leitungen mit externer Interrupt-Fähigkeit (flanken- oder pegelempfindlich), Entprellung, Glitchfilterung und On-Die-SerienwiderstandsabschlussDrei parallele 32-Bit-Eingangs-/Ausgangs-Controller, Peripherie-DMA-unterstützter paralleler Erfassungsmodus16-Kanal, 1Msps ADC mit differentiellem Eingangsmodus und programmierbarer Verstärkungsstufe2-Kanal 12-Bit 1Msps DACEin Analogkomparator mit flexibler Eingangsauswahl, wählbare EingangshystereseSerieller Wire/JTAG-Debug-Anschluss (SWJ-DP)Debug-Zugang zu allen Speichern und Registern im System, einschließlich der Cortex-M4-Registerbank, wenn der Core läuft, angehalten oder in Reset gehalten wird.Debug-Zugriff über Serial Wire Debug Port (SW-DP) und Serial Wire JTAG Debug Port (SWJ-DP).Flash-Patch- und Breakpoint-Einheit (FPB) zur Implementierung von Breakpoints und Code-Patches.Daten-Watchpoint- und Trace-Einheit (DWT) zur Implementierung von Watchpoints, Daten-Tracing und System-Profiling.Instrumentation Trace Macrocell (ITM) zur Unterstützung von Debugging im printf-Stil.IEEE1149.1 JTAG Boundary-Scan an allen digitalen Pins.ASF-Atmel Software Framework - SAM-Software-EntwicklungsrahmenIntegriert in die Atmel Studio IDE mit einer grafischen Benutzeroberfläche oder als Standalone für GCC, IAR Compiler verfügbar.DMA-Unterstützung, Interrupt-Handler TreiberunterstützungUSB, TCP/IP, Wi-Fi und Bluetooth, zahlreiche USB-Klassen, DHCP und Wi-Fi-Verschlüsselung StacksRTOS-Integration, FreeRTOS ist eine Kernkomponente
Deine Shops für beste Deals
reichelt elektronik
Logge dich ein für Coupon Details